BALLER MOVE: Add in 12+ Team Leagues
ROSTERED IN: 45% of Leagues
ANALYSIS: Minnesota Vikings quarterback Joshua Dobbs has been one of the best stories of the season, starting for both the Cardinals and Vikings. He's coming off his worst game of the year, but the 28-year-old had two or more total touchdowns in the four games prior.
There were some whispers that Dobbs could potentially be benched out of the bye, but I don't buy that for a second. Who are they going to start over him? Nick Mullens? Nope, I'm sorry, I'm not buying it. In his first two starts with the Vikings, he scored over 24 points. Dating back to his earlier days with Arizona, he has five games with more than 23 points this season. He has five weeks as a top-10 quarterback and has another three weeks where he finished between QB11-QB16. In his third game with Minnesota, he scored 16.9 points before imploding against Chicago, finishing with just 4.5 points in Week 12.
Dobbs has been one of the best rushing quarterbacks this season. He has 400 yards and six touchdowns and it's this element of his game that gives him both a nice floor and a very high ceiling. In 11 games where Dobbs has played over half the snaps, he has eight games with more than 16 points. He's been a very dependable fantasy asset. I'd be shocked if he's benched. He's averaged 18.6 in those 11 games, which is the same PPG average as Brock Purdy, who is currently QB12 on the season.
Dobbs has a tough matchup coming out of the bye against Las Vegas. They've given up the 22nd-most points to quarterbacks this season, but he'll have had an extra week to prepare and Justin Jefferson will be back. Then in Weeks 15 and 16, Dobbs will get two of the better matchups in the first two weeks of the fantasy football playoffs. He'll play the Bengals and Lions. They've allowed the 12th- and fifth-most points to opposing quarterbacks, respectively. Barring a surprise benching, Dobbs will likely flirt with a top-12 ranking in Weeks 15 and 16.
